  • 5-8-2010 west bay

    Set off from fatboys with ZORK to the Pig Pens arriving at sunrise. The wind was not that bad, but soon after arriving, the front pushed through with winds increasing. Tough winds from NNE,NE,ENE, E 10 to 20 MPH hounded us all day. Bait was present, but it was like fishing in a bad surf. Not a strike.

    We checked out Sand Island and Campbell's , but they were raked by the NE wind. Fished the SW bank of Pelican Island without results and moved on to North Deer Island to wade. No better luck there.

      Settled into a West Bay back marsh off the intracoastal where ZORK managed a flounder and trout under a popping cork with a GULP shad. Water had about 3 " visibility.

        Moved to another marsh off the intracoastal where we fished a cut and caught some rat reds and keeper flounder on GULP chartruese curly tails.

          Ended up with about 7 flounder and and one trout. I got hung up on the bottom and broke my G.L.Loomis rod !! Bummer. It was an old rod and I had a backup...but still. We hit one more cut briefly and headed back to Fatboy's....ZORK had some power shopping to do yet for Mother's Day. It was a tough weather day , but we managed some fish and had a great time.
